SL33Z08.28B0T_C++_
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
"SL33Z08.28B0T_C++_" 暗示着这可能是一个关于C++编程的学习资源或者项目代码库,其中"SL33Z08.28B0T"可能是一个特定版本的标识或者命名规则。C++是一种广泛应用的面向对象的编程语言,以其强大的性能、灵活性和丰富的库支持而闻名。 "the best feeling in the world you wont regret" 提供的是情感上的描述,暗示学习或掌握C++可能会带来极大的满足感和无悔的体验。在编程领域,熟练掌握C++往往意味着能够编写高效、低级别的系统级代码,这在游戏开发、操作系统、嵌入式系统等领域非常有价值。 C++的知识点包括但不限于以下几点: 1. **基础语法**:包括变量、数据类型、运算符、流程控制(如if语句、switch语句、循环)等,这些都是所有编程语言的基础。 2. **类与对象**:C++的核心特性是面向对象编程,理解类的定义、对象的创建和销毁、封装、继承和多态性是必要的。 3. **函数**:函数用于组织代码,可以是成员函数(属于某个类)或非成员函数。理解函数参数、重载和模板函数的概念很重要。 4. **指针**:C++中的指针是其强大但复杂的一部分,理解指针的声明、使用和操作,以及指针与引用的关系,对于理解和优化代码至关重要。 5. **标准库**:STL(Standard Template Library)提供了容器(如vector、list、set)、迭代器、算法和内存管理工具,是C++编程的必备知识。 6. **异常处理**:学习如何使用try、catch和throw进行错误处理,以确保程序的健壮性。 7. **模板**:C++的模板允许创建泛型代码,可以应用于不同数据类型,提高代码的复用性。 8. **命名空间**:命名空间用于避免全局命名冲突,是组织代码的重要工具。 9. **内存管理**:了解动态内存分配(new和delete)和智能指针(如unique_ptr、shared_ptr),以及内存泄漏的预防。 10. **C++11及以后的更新**:C++11引入了许多新特性,如lambda表达式、右值引用、auto关键字等,这些增强了语言的现代性和可读性。 通过深入学习和实践这些知识点,可以逐步提升C++编程能力,体验到描述中所说的“无悔”的编程旅程。同时,从压缩包内的文件名"US[9A18CF8A543A485DD911BBC0316FE19A] [2020-08-22T06_54_57.8245222]"来看,可能是某个特定文件的唯一标识或时间戳,这可能是项目日志、编译输出或者其他相关记录。为了充分利用这个资源,你需要解压文件并查看具体内容,以便进一步学习和理解C++的相关知识。
- 1
- 粉丝: 62
- 资源: 4712
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- mongodb证书一键生成工具
- 新文字文件 (7).7z
- BiLSTM-Attention双向长短期记忆网络融合注意力机制多变量多步预测,光伏功率预测(Matlab完整源码和数据)
- 【Unity样条线插件】Curvy Splines 8 快速生成平滑的样条曲线和路径
- 面向移动设备的实时图像去噪轻量级网络研究
- Downloading efficientteacher-main.zip
- 梦幻西游道人20241025f-shimen.py
- 基于JSP的高校听课评价系统+jsp
- 医学图像分割数据集:基于MR下的人体脊柱图像分割数据集(20类别分割,包含标签,约1700张数据和标签)
- 基于ssm+vue的中国版Blackboard学习系统实现+vue